Porky is indeed a boss in Subspace Emissary
It appears to me:
1) The controls have been improved. I prefer to use the Gamecube controller, and I can see a difference in the way this one handles, as opposed to Melee. Or maybe my coordination has improved.
2) The graphics are lovely. The detail on the characters is very impressive. The only thing is, Mario has slimmed down considerably, and his arms freak me out. They seem to demonstrate how huge his head is, and I can't look at him for to long or I get scared.
3) The story mode is interesting and challenging.
4) Am I the only one who gets a serious Kingdom Hearts vibe from this game? I think its the coloring, the shading and the bosses and minions.

However, the times I did get to play Melee at a friend's or whatever, I found the controls to be awful, and I don't think there was any way to customize them. So I agree, Dorothy, that the controls have been improved. I love the customization ability but I can use the default just fine, which surprises me, because I suck at the Melee Gamecube controls.
The story mode adds a lot, I think. That was one thing that always disappointed me about both of the previous SSBs, no real plot. SubSpace Emissary is really cute and fun, though, as well as a good way to kind of be forced to play with characters you wouldn't normally choose to play with, and discover that you might be able to kick butt with that one.
It's also great that there's so much to do. I only have a couple levels left to beat on the SSE on normal, yet there's still so much to unlock and so many little subtle secrets hidden throughout the game.
I also think what they did with the addition/subtraction of characters was pretty good, though I still could think of a few characters they should have added. And they all look beautiful. I even find myself pausing from time to time just to get a closer look at the old game characters in their new, sleek forms.
Great online play, great multiplayer play.
